Abstract
The autoradiographic method with L-[S-35]methionine was used to determ ine the effects of an n-3 fatty acid deficiency on brain protein synth esis. Brain protein synthesis was significantly increased (from 50 to 150%) in 45 of the 52 brain structures studied in n-3 fatty acid-defic ient rats as compared with control animals. Biochemical analysis confi rmed the increase in overall rate of protein synthesis in brain as a w hole.
